Victor Davis Hanson: The secret that Biden, Obama, Hillary won't say aloud about today's Democratic Party
foxnews.com ^ | 7-17-2021 | Victor Davis Hanson

Posted on 07/17/2021 7:51:47 AM PDT by boycott

"The two parties are switching class constituents. Some 65% of the Americans making more than $500,000 a year are Democrats, and 74% of those who earn less than $100,000 a year are Republicans, according to IRS statistics."

"In the recent presidential primaries and general election, 17 of the 20 wealthiest ZIP codes gave more money to Democratic candidates than to Republicans"
